In 1999, I was graduating from seminary and my little sister was graduating from college, so Mom and Daddy planned a surprise vacation for us. They'd told us to hold the dates, but we both figured we were going to the beach since the timing matched up with when we usually went. Well, at Thanksgving Dinner, Daddy went into their bedroom and came out with 2 shoe boxes all wrapped up. Mom looked at him with "the look" and said, "I thought we were going to wait until at least Christmas." Daddy's response was that *he* couldn't wait any longer.

So we opened the boxes and each found a Disney character picture frame ~ the kind where the characters are holding the frame part that slides in and out of their hands as they peek around it ~ with a little piece of paper where the picture goes saying "We're looking forward to seeing *YOU* with your family at the Caribbean Beach Resort May 26-30." (My sister got Mickey characters and I got Pooh characters ~ reflecting our personal faves...I love Mickey to death, but I've always been a Pooh girl at heart.) It was really cool ~ so that's one possible suggestion of how to tell them when you're ready! Others may have other ideas.
